Obama Nominates Maria Echaveste for Ambassador to Mexico

By Suzzane Gamboa, NBC News

President Barack Obama is nominating Maria Echaveste, a former Clinton White House official, to be next ambassador to Mexico. If confirmed, she would be the first woman in that post, as White House Domestic Policy Director Cecilia Muñoz tweeted.

The White House announced the nomination Thursday saying “while Echaveste has been actively involved in the effort to pass sensible immigration reform, she understands that the relationship between the United States and Mexico goes well beyond issues of immigration reform, including critical trade and commerce alliances.”
